Tools and Materials Needed
- Safety Gear: Safety glasses, gloves, and ear protection are a must. The cutting operation can generate flying debris, and the noise can be harmful to your ears.
- Wrenches and Screwdrivers: Depending on the design of your Cutting Chamber Body, you'll need the appropriate wrenches and screwdrivers to remove the covers and access the blades.
- Replacement Blades: Make sure you have the correct type and size of replacement blades for your specific Cutting Chamber Body.
- Cleaning Supplies: A brush and some cleaning solvent can be used to clean the chamber after removing the old blades.
Step - by - Step Guide to Blade Replacement
Step 1: Power Off and Lockout
The first and most important step is to power off the cutting machine. Unplug it from the power source or turn off the circuit breaker if it's hard - wired. Then, use a lockout - tagout device to prevent anyone from accidentally turning the machine back on while you're working on it. This is a critical safety measure to avoid serious injuries.
Step 2: Access the Cutting Chamber
Locate the access panels or covers on the Cutting Chamber Body. Use the appropriate wrenches or screwdrivers to remove the fasteners holding these covers in place. Carefully set the covers aside in a safe place. You may need to refer to the machine's manual if you're unsure about the location of the access points.
Step 3: Remove the Old Blades
Once you have access to the cutting blades, you'll notice that they are usually held in place by bolts, clamps, or other fastening mechanisms. Use the correct tools to loosen and remove these fasteners. Be cautious when handling the old blades as they may still be sharp. Some blades may be heavy, so use proper lifting techniques to avoid back injuries.
Step 4: Clean the Cutting Chamber
After removing the old blades, take the time to clean the inside of the Cutting Chamber Body. Use a brush to remove any debris, dust, or residue left behind by the old blades. You can also use a cleaning solvent to wipe down the surfaces for a more thorough clean. This will ensure that the new blades fit properly and operate smoothly.
Step 5: Install the New Blades
Carefully place the new blades in the same position as the old ones. Make sure they are aligned correctly and that all the holes and mounting points match up. Then, use the fasteners to secure the new blades in place. Tighten the bolts or clamps to the manufacturer's recommended torque settings. Over - tightening can damage the blades or the Cutting Chamber Body, while under - tightening can cause the blades to come loose during operation.
Step 6: Reassemble the Cutting Chamber
Once the new blades are installed, replace the access panels or covers. Make sure they are properly aligned and that all the fasteners are tightened securely. This will prevent any debris from entering the chamber during operation and also ensure the safety of the machine.
Step 7: Power On and Test
After reassembling the Cutting Chamber Body, remove the lockout - tagout device and power on the machine. Perform a test run at a low speed to check if the new blades are functioning correctly. Listen for any unusual noises or vibrations, which could indicate a problem with the installation. If everything seems to be working fine, you can gradually increase the speed to the normal operating level.
Troubleshooting Tips
- Uneven Cutting: If the cutting is uneven, it could be due to misaligned blades. Check the alignment and re - tighten the fasteners if necessary.
- Excessive Noise or Vibration: This may be a sign that the blades are not balanced or that there is a problem with the mounting. Stop the machine immediately and re - check the installation.
- Blade Wear: If the new blades start to wear out quickly, it could be because of incorrect blade selection or improper operating conditions. Review the manufacturer's recommendations and adjust accordingly.
